Chloro-cob(II)alamin formation enhances the thiol oxidase activity of the B(12)-trafficking protein CblC

CblC is a chaperone that catalyzes removal of the β−axial ligand of cobalamin (or B(12)), generating cob(II)alamin in an early step in the cofactor trafficking pathway. Cob(II)alamin is subsequently partitioned to support cellular needs for the synthesis of the active cobalamin cofactor derivatives....
